Straw marquetry is a very old technique. It was used a lot in the 17th and 18th century, especially to decorate boxes and other utilitarian objects, but also to create paintings and wall panels. Then she fell into oblivion. A renewed interest emerged in the 1930s thanks to great decorative artists. The author chose to apply straw marquetry to the framing, which explains the large number of friezes explained in this book, which you can of course also apply to cardboard, furniture decoration, etc. The method is simple and clearly explained. Many tips are offered in order to acquire greater speed in executing patterns. The technique is thus acquired very quickly to leave room for imagination and creation. Passionate about the decorative arts, Anne-Marie Choain-Degand loves patterns and geometric figures. Her eye is always attracted by an ornamental detail or a juxtaposition of colors. She found in working with straw the possibility of bringing her fantasies to life.
